Bath Installation Associate, Home Renovation & Carpentry
Overview
Own on-site bath installation projects, coordinating with the lead installer to deliver high-quality remodels at scale. Work with a network of renovation teams across multiple states and contribute to a streamlined installation process. Collaborate with management to ensure customer satisfaction and accurate final payments. Bring carpentry experience and strong communication to a fast-growing home improvement company.
What You'll Do6
- 1Assist the Lead Installer in installing home remodeling products per guidelines
- 2Set up jobsites and maintain a clean work area after installations
- 3Apply finish work for construction applications
- 4Communicate with management to ensure customer satisfaction and authorize final payments
- 5Complete carpentry checklists with homeowners at project completion
- 6Collect final payment and handle install paperwork with homeowners
Requirements6
- 1Bath Installation or carpentry experience
- 26+ months of remodeling, carpentry, or construction experience
- 3Valid driver’s license and good driving record
- 4Strong communication and customer service skills
- 5Physical stamina to work outdoors for extended periods
- 6Provide own hand tools
